E10
Saturn
Lid Not Locked / Safety Interlock Error
E10 appears when trying to start any program; unit beeps and cancels.

Possible Causes
Lid lock solenoid not engaging, Broken lid lock mechanism, Misaligned lid latch, Faulty lid lock sensor on control board
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Always ensure the cooker is not under pressure before working on the lid lock. Unplug the unit.
Step-by-step checks:
- 1. Confirm lid lock operation: Close the lid and listen for a mechanical click or slight motor/solenoid sound (on models with motorized locks). If there is no sound, the lock may not be energizing.
- 2. Clean latch and lock: Remove any food debris from the latch hook and lock slot. Sticky residue can prevent full engagement.
- 3. Inspect lock parts: Remove the inner lid cover to access the lock mechanism. Check for broken plastic levers or springs. Replace the lid lock assembly if parts are cracked.
- 4. Electrical check (advanced): With the bottom cover removed, locate the lid lock solenoid or motor wires. Ensure the connector is firmly attached to the PCB. Check for visible damage or burnt smell.
- 5. Test again: Reassemble and test. If E10 persists and the lock never engages, the solenoid or its driver circuit on the PCB may be faulty.
Warning: Do not attempt to bypass the lid lock; it is a critical safety feature for pressure operation.
